Response Strengthened
This term describes the process by which a behavior becomes more likely to occur as a result of reinforcement.
Negative Reinforcement
A behavioral principle where the removal of an unpleasant stimulus following a desired behavior increases the likelihood of the behavior occurring again.
Positive Reinforcement
A method of strengthening desired behaviors by presenting a desirable stimulus after the behavior occurs.
Probability
A measure or estimation of how likely it is that an event will occur, expressed as a number between 0 and 1, where 1 denotes certainty.
